Overview

Assessment of the Lower Limb is the benchmark textbook of lower limb examination and assessment. The third edition preserves the lucidity, logical approach and comprehensive coverage of its predecessors but adds many new exciting features, including an all-new color design, color line drawings, new contributors, thorough updating of all chapters - many of which have been completely rewritten - and an entirely new chapter on functional assessment.The DVD provides extensive videos of assessment techniques and illustrations: practitioners with patients and models show how to assess all parts of the lower limb, and evaluate various conditions. Together with its companion volume Clinical Skills in Treating the Foot , the third edition of Merriman's Assessment of the Lower Limb is a truly indispensable guide for podiatry students and practitioners, as well as trainee general practitioners, medical students working in rheumatology, diabetology and orthopedics, sports therapists and sports medicine trainees.
